Created from the merger of three leading Finnish universities on 1 January Three Schools: School of Economics School of Art and Design School of Science and Technology Second biggest university in Finland Total Annual budget: € 368 million (2009) Composition (2009) 4,500 Staff (300 professors) 20,000 Students 75, 000 Alumni 1600 master’s degrees 180 doctoral degrees 473 MBA/EMBA degrees Aalto University at a glance

Aalto University aims to be acknowledged as a world-class university in the field of technology, business & art by the year 2020.

The Name of Aalto University

Alvar Aalto (1898–1976) Distinguished himself in the fields of technology, business and art. Diploma in Architecture from Helsinki University of Technology Founder of Artek 1935 Professor MIT (1946–1948) Aalto Quotes “Building art is synthesis of life in materialized form. We should try to bring in under the same hat not a splintered way of thinking, but all in harmony together.” Alvar Aalto

Foundation and partners

The Charter of Foundation was signed in June Its seven-member Board was appointed in August 2008 by the Finnish Government and representatives of external funding. Contributions as per the Charter of Foundation: Finnish Government contributes € 500 million towards the basic capital of the University. Donations of at least € 200 million are to be collected. Additional Government funding will be allocated to Aalto University for years The University is managed by the Aalto University Foundation

Partners Finnish Government Federation of Finnish Technology Industries Technology Industries of Finland Centennial Foundation Foundation for Economic Education Confederation of Finnish Industry and Employers Finnish Association of Graduate Engineers Finnish Association of Business School Graduates

Aalto Design Factory (1) Design Factory is a common platform, innovative factory building for Aalto students, researches and other staff members and their partners -Established in 2007 – ”being the 1st Aalto” unit, (Aalto University Foundation started the operations ) - Situated in Otaniemi campus, Espoo ( m2) -Design Factory is connected to electrical engineering and electronics, automation, architecture, mechanical engineering, materials science and engineering, computer science, and industrial engineering and management

Aalto Design Factory (2) The School of Art and Design is represented by the fields of textile art and clothing design, industrial design and environmental art. -The School of Economics is linked to the Factory through marketing, international business and innovations. Ideal innovation development infrasturcture for passionate people - Active involvement of big companies (Nokia, KONE) and DF has also own start-up unit (Venture Garage)

Aalto Design Factory (3) Design Factory established in co-operation with Tongji Univeristy Aalto-Tongji Design Factory, in Shanghai China hours videoconference connection between DF Otanieniemi to ATDF Shanghai -Future basis for Aalto operations in Asia

Aalto Design Factory (4) Active participation in the Shanghai World Expo “Better City – Better Life” ( ) - implemented in 2010: Aalto on Tracks (100 aaltoes by train to World Expo); 24 Chinese Experiences in Finland; Helsinki Higher Education Days in World Expo, Aalto LAB Shanghai
